  Case: Shy does not talk
There is a student that is so shy that they will not speak to peers or the teacher. What would you do to get the student to open up and start talking?

I went through this in fourth grade and I refused to speak to others. From what I can remember, the teacher made it clear that If I needed something, I was going to have to use my words. Eventually I reached out and broke out of my shell. I think that the teacher should have a conversation with the student, see what may be the reason. Setting up a meeting with the parents can be beneficial.
